Frequently Asked Questions

What is the average MOT pass rate for a Mitsubishi Warrior?

The Mitsubishi Warrior has an average 66.7% MOT pass rate across model years 2004 to 2012, based on DVSA test data.

What are the most common MOT failures on a Mitsubishi Warrior?

The most common MOT failure reasons for the Mitsubishi Warrior across all years are: a suspension pin, bush or joint excessively worn, brake pipe damaged or excessively corroded, a lamp missing, inoperative or in the case of a multiple light source more than 1/2 not functioning. These are typical wear items that can often be checked and addressed before your test.
